What Are Weather Seals?
Weather seals are materials used around doors, windows, and other openings in structures to prevent air and water infiltration. Types of Weather Seals
There are different types of weather seals, each designed for particular applications and materials. The following list describes the most typical types:
Compression Seals: Made from products such as rubber or foam, these seals are developed to compress when a door or window closes, producing a tight seal.
Felt Seals: Traditionally made from wool or synthetic fibers, felt seals are often used in older homes due to their cost-effectiveness.
Vinyl Seals: These resilient, versatile seals are typically utilized in doors and windows to provide exceptional air and wetness resistance.
Magnetic Seals: Utilized generally in fridges and some windows, magnetic seals develop a safe and secure bond that prevents air leakage.
Limit Seals: Placed at the bottom of doors, these seals prevent drafts and water from going into a structure.

Installation of Weather Seals
Installing weather seals can be a DIY task or a task for a professional, depending upon the intricacy and kind of seal. Here are some actions to assist correct installation:
Step-by-Step Weather Seal Installation
Evaluate the Area: Inspect doors, windows, and other potential areas for drafts and water infiltration.
Choose the Right Seal: Based on the particular requirements of each opening, choose the proper weather condition seal type.
Clean the Surface: Ensure the location where the weather condition seal will be installed is tidy and dry. Eliminate any old seals and particles.
Measure and Cut: Measure the dimensions of the location where the seal will go. Cut the weather condition seal product to the required length.
Apply the Seal: For adhesive-backed seals, remove the protective support and firmly push the seal into location. Ensure it is lined up properly.
Test the Seal: Close the window or door to evaluate the efficiency of the seal. Try to find any gaps where air may get away.
Change as Necessary: If necessary, change or trim the seals to make sure a tight fit.

Frequently Asked Questions About Weather Seals
Q1: How do I know if I need to replace my weather seals?
A: Signs that you need to change your weather condition seals consist of drafts, increased energy expenses, noticeable spaces around windows and doors, and water spots or indications of wetness inside your home.
Q2: Can I set up weather condition seals myself?
A: Yes, numerous weather condition sealing products are created for simple DIY setup. Nevertheless, for intricate installations or if you're uncertain, it might be best to seek advice from a professional.
Q3: How frequently should I inspect my weather condition seals?
A: It's suggested to check your weather condition seals at least as soon as a year, especially before the heating or cooling season begins.
